A Node Module to download RTMP Videos
A Node Module to download RTMP videos. Important: This Module requires the C lib rtmpdump. rmtpdump for Mac
var rtmp = require('rtmp-download');
var config = {
src: 'rtmp://video.url/video.mp4',
target: '/home/user/videos/video.mp4',
onProgress: function(data) {},
onExit: function(data) {},
onError: function(error) {}
};
rtmp.download(config);
$ npm install --save rtmp-download
The data
object of the callbacks onProgress
and onExit
contains the following data:
{
kbLoaded: 12345,
secondsLoaded: 12,
percent: 10.5
}